There are 3 main points to remember when it comes to money:

1. Money is energy. It is directed by our thoughts and can take any form that we collectively agree upon----coins, papers, checks, cows in some places. This is important to return to when you are pricing your services. In business, we exchange energy through services and products for money. It is also something to remember when it comes time to invest in your business, either through equipment or mentoring or other forms of improvement.

2. Money must flow. If there is a barrier to that flow, in the thought forms of scarcity or greed or guilt, it will get damned up and float. It won’t reach you, but will float rather than flow in your life. This is much harder if you have grown up in a family where there was actual poverty or a poverty mindset, but is something that you can transform.

3. Money is love. It comes to us through others, not from others. It is, as the quote by Sri Aurobindo, “the visible sign of a universal force.” If you look at your relationship with money, you will learn a great deal about the way love works in your life as well.

If you don’t pay attention to money, it is not unlike being in a relationship where you don’t pay much attention to the person. Eventually that person will begin to drift away from you for lack of attention, and go elsewhere. Ask yourself if that has happened to you.

On the other hand, if you are obsessed with money---or with the lack of money------think about what happens when you are obsessed with a person in your life. Eventually they will try to get away from your grasping. Ask yourself if this has happened to you.
